On the bounds for the curvature and higher derivatives of the Isgur-Wise function

We discuss constraints imposed on the zero-recoil curvature and higher derivatives of the Isgur-Wise function by a general quark model. These constraints are expressed as bounds for a given slope parameter, and compared with those based upon analyticity properties of QCD spectral functions. Our results also indicate that in the analysis of the experimental data for semileptonic $B\rar D^{(*)}$ decays it may be important to include at least the third term in the form factor expansion about the zero recoil point.
